Accessible summaryPeople with severe mental ill health are up to three times more likely to smoke than other members of the general population.Life expectancy in this client group is reduced by up to 30 years, and smoking is the single most important cause of premature death.The aim of this study was to explore why people with severe mental ill health smoked and why they might want to stop smoking...
Lesion-detection performance in oncologic PET depends in part upon count statistics, with shorter scans having higher noise and reduced lesion detectability. However, advanced techniques such as time-of-flight (TOF) and point spread function (PSF) modeling can improve lesion detectability. This work investigates the relationship between reducing count levels (as a surrogate for scan time) and reconstructing...
